Union Home Minister Amit Shah launched a scathing attack on the Congress party during an election rally in Kushinagar. He predicted that Congress leaders would convene a press conference on June 4th, following the election results, and lay blame on electronic voting machines (EVMs) for their anticipated loss.

Shah asserted that while Rahul Gandhi and Priyanka Gandhi would not be held responsible for the defeat, party president Mallikarjun Kharge would likely lose his position.

Shah claimed to possess insider information regarding the initial five phases of the Lok Sabha polls, asserting that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) had secured over 310 seats across these phases.

In contrast, he predicted dismal outcomes for Rahul Gandhi, estimating fewer than 40 seats, and for Akhilesh Yadav’s Samajwadi Party, projecting fewer than 4 seats in the upcoming election results.

The Home Minister took jabs at Rahul Gandhi and Akhilesh Yadav, accusing them of being disconnected from the challenges faced by the people of eastern Uttar Pradesh. He alleged that both leaders were born into privilege, unlike PM Modi, who emerged from a humble background.

Shah further criticized their alleged frequent vacations and claimed they lacked the endurance to withstand the rigors of Indian politics, contrasting this with PM Modi’s consistent dedication without any leave during his tenure.

Shah also levied accusations of corruption against Rahul Gandhi and Akhilesh Yadav, claiming their involvement in scandals worth ₹12 lakh crore, without providing specific details. In contrast, he highlighted PM Modi’s unblemished record, asserting that no corruption allegations had tarnished his tenure as chief minister or prime minister.

In addition to his criticism of the Congress and its leaders, Amit Shah addressed the issue of the Ram temple, accusing the SP government of violence against Ram devotees and blaming the Congress for stalling the temple’s construction for 70 years.

He praised PM Modi’s contributions to the temple’s construction, including the groundbreaking ceremony (bhoomipujan), participation in consecration ceremonies (pran pratishtha), and initiatives to renovate revered temples like Kashi Vishwanath and Somnath, emphasizing the BJP’s commitment to Hindu sentiments.
